Butterfinger Balls are the perfect dessert for anyone who wants big flavor without turning on the oven. These no-bake treats combine creamy peanut butter, buttery graham cracker crumbs, powdered sugar, and crushed Butterfinger bars into a soft, sweet dough packed with crunch and caramel-like candy flavor. Rolled into bite-sized balls and coated in melted chocolate, each piece delivers a rich mix of smooth, crispy, and melt-in-your-mouth textures. With only a handful of simple pantry ingredients, this recipe is quick to prepare, making it ideal for busy days, last-minute gatherings, or homemade gift boxes. The ease of preparation means anyone can make a batch in minutes, yet the result looks and tastes like a specialty confection.
What makes Butterfinger Balls especially appealing is their versatility. They can be fully dipped in chocolate for a classic candy look, drizzled for a decorative finish, or topped with extra crushed Butterfinger pieces, sprinkles, or even a touch of sea salt for contrast. After a short chill in the freezer, they firm up into perfectly snackable treats that store well in the fridge.
